Three OneAmerica Clients Earn Industry Recognition for Retirement Plans

Winner and two finalists for 2016 PLANSPONSOR honor emphasize participant education

Indianapolis, March 31, 2016

Clients of the Companies of OneAmerica earned U.S. retirement industry recognition today for their retirement plans and emphasis on participant education, led by Mental Health Cooperative, named a 2016 PLANSPONSOR of the Year winner in the 403(b) category.

Honored as finalists were Dupuy Storage and Forwarding LLC, a New Orleans, Louisiana-based port warehouse and logistics company, in PLANSPONSOR’s Corporate 401(k) <$15M category; and Medical Associates of Northeast Arkansas, or MANA, of Fayetteville, Arkansas, in the Corporate 401(k) $50M - $200M. 

“These plan sponsors are true leaders in helping their employees understand retirement readiness,” said Bill Yoerger, President, OneAmerica Retirement Services. “They are dedicated, forward-thinking, and driven to achieve with a participant-first approach that’s second to none.”

Mental Health Cooperative, a nonprofit based in Nashville, Tennessee, reported a 93 percent participation rate, with its employees deferring an average of 6.8 percent to company-designated plan.

“We work exceptionally hard so that our workforce understands how critical it is to invest now, while they are in the beginning phases of their careers. It’s a financial backbone,” said Michael Kirshner, vice president of business development at Mental Health Cooperative.

MANA has an employee participation rate of 94 percent, with each participant deferring an average of 8 percent. Dupuy has a participation rate of 91 percent, with average deferral rate of 5.72%.

The participation rate is higher than the industry averages as measured by Employment Benefit Research Institute.[1]

PLANSPONSOR, a monthly magazine published by Asset International, presents honors in nine categories. Nominations are accepted from a variety of sources across the industry—including providers, advisers, consultants, actuaries, attorneys, third-party administrators (TPAs), employees and colleagues. All nominees are then asked to supply details about their plan’s administration, participant statistics and data such as participation rates. A committee of PLANSPONSOR editors reviews the submissions and selects the winners and finalists from among the various categories.

“These are leaders in retirement planning best practices, working to provide more secure financial outcomes for their workers,” said Alison Cooke Mintzer, editor-in-chief of PLANSPONSOR.

Awards will be handed out March 31 in New York City.
